RUMFORD – Funeral services for Maurice Voter of Rumford were held Thursday morning, July 21, at 10 a.m., from the Wiles Remembrance Center, 42 Weld St., Dixfield, with Deacon Rod Berger officiating. The Swasey-Torrey American Legion Post of Dixfield held public legion services the night before at the funeral home. Members of Lane Dube Amvets Post 33 and the Frank L. Mitchell VFW Post 3335 of Jay conducted full military honors at the Demerritt Cemetery, Peru, following services. Those members were under the command of Dick Therrien. Firing Squad members were Richard Dupont, Wayne Piel, Roland Giguere, Joe Grooms, Wayne Parker, Raoul Laplante and Mike Wadsworth. The Honor Guard members were Harvey Sabin, Francis Therrien and Greg MacDonald. The flag was presented by Don LeSuer. Pallbearers were Joe Gendron, Kane Cottle, Don Gray, Chris Edmond, Norman Voter and Charlie Voter. His two grandsons, Colin and Thomas, served as honorary bearers. Following services, a reception was held at the American Legion Hall in Dixfield. Arrangements were in the care of the Wiles Remembrance Center, Dixfield.
